“Peripheral vascular disease is characterized by narrowing of the arteries, reducing blood flow to the legs, arms, brain and other organs. The cause, in most cases, is atherosclerosis (hardening of the arteries). The arteries become narrowed by cholesterol-containing fat (plaque) that builds up and hardens inside the arteries. People with peripheral vascular disease are at high risk for heart attack and stroke. While peripheral vascular disease is common — about 10 million people in the United States are affected — only about one in four is diagnosed and receives treatment.” –Mayo ClinicLinkIt says little about treatment, but it says there is treatment.
